Recipe: Monster Shrimp with Orange Chili Glaze
Appetizers and SnacksMONSTER SHRIMP WITH ORANGE CHILI GLAZE
1/2 cup freshly squeezed orange juice (about 2 oranges)
1/2 cup cilantro
1 tablespoon Asian red chili paste
1/4 cup extra-virgin olive oil
2 garlic cloves
3 scallions, green parts only, cut into 1-inch pieces
1 chipotle chili in adobo sauce
1/2 teaspoon salt
2 pounds extra-large shrimp (16-20-count size), shelled and deveined
Put the orange juice, cilantro, chili paste, olive oil, garlic, scallion, chipotle and salt in a blender or food processor fitted with metal blade, and blend until smooth.
Place shrimp in freezer bag and pour orange juice mixture over shrimp. Chill in refrigerator or ice-filled cooler for 2-3 hours, but no longer.
Remove shrimp from marinade and discard marinade.
Grill shrimp over medium-high heat until they are opaque in center, 3-4 minutes per side. Remove from heat and serve immediately, although they still rock at room temperature.
Source: Mario Tailgates NASCAR Style by Mario Batali
